Why These Are the Top Volvo Repair Auto Repair Shops in Fernwood

** The Volvo repair market for Fernwood residents is entirely dependent on the nearby city of Hattiesburg. Fernwood itself lacks any dedicated automotive specialists. The Hattiesburg market features a healthy level of competition among several high-quality independent European auto shops, but no dedicated Volvo-only specialist or a standalone Volvo dealership. The absence of a dealership means owners rely on these independent experts, who generally offer significant cost savings over dealer prices while maintaining high levels of expertise. The average quality of service is high, as evidenced by the consistently strong reviews for the top shops. Pricing is typical for European auto repair, with diagnostic fees ranging from $120-$150 and labor rates between $110-$140 per hour. For highly specialized services like advanced safety system recalibration (e.g., after a windshield replacement), some shops may partner with or refer to specialized mobile calibration services. For hybrid and electric "Recharge" models, the technical expertise is present at these top shops, but it is always recommended to confirm a technician's specific experience with Volvo's PHEV systems before booking an appointment.

Are there specialized Volvo repair shops in Fernwood, MS, or will I need to travel to a larger city?

Fernwood is a small community, so there are no dedicated Volvo dealerships or specialty shops within the town itself. For complex Volvo-specific repairs, owners often travel to nearby cities like Hattiesburg or McComb, though some local general mechanics in the Fernwood area may handle basic maintenance and common issues on European vehicles.

What are the most common Volvo repair issues for drivers in the Fernwood area given our local climate and roads?

Given Mississippi's heat and humidity, Volvo cooling system components and electrical sensors can be prone to premature wear. Additionally, the rural roads around Fernwood can be tough on suspension components, making control arm bushings and struts common repair items for local Volvo models like the XC90 or S60.

How can I find a trustworthy mechanic for my Volvo near Fernwood?

Seek out shops in neighboring towns that explicitly list European or Volvo service, and always check for online reviews and local testimonials. A reliable indicator is a shop that uses quality, brand-specific diagnostic tools and sources genuine or OEM Volvo parts, which is crucial for proper repair.

When should I seek immediate service for my Volvo instead of waiting for a routine appointment?

You should seek immediate service for dashboard warning lights like the check engine light flashing, the red temperature warning light, or any signs of transmission failure. Given the distances to major repair centers from Fernwood, addressing these warnings promptly can prevent being stranded on rural routes.

Is Volvo repair more expensive in our area due to the lack of local dealerships?

Labor rates may be slightly lower at independent shops in the Fernwood region compared to dealerships in big cities, but part costs and potential travel for specialty service can offset savings. It's wise to get detailed estimates that include part sourcing (often requiring shipping) and a clear labor rate to understand the total cost.
